A Line of Bankrupt Airlines in Indonesian Aviation History

Jakarta – The position of Garuda Indonesia is rumored to be replaced by Pelita Air Service as the main state-owned airline. Garuda’s poor condition and difficult to save were the triggers.

In fact, Pelita Air is currently said to have obtained a scheduled flight permit. Spokesman for the Ministry of Transportation Adita Irawati said the business license had been issued. Pelita Air’s plan to resume operations is getting closer.

In the history of aviation in the country, there are a number of airlines that have experienced financial difficulties until they were forced to go out of business.
